Is Elgin, IL or Salem, OR safer?

Elgin is safer with a higher safety score by 12 points. Elgin, IL has a safety score of 73/100 while Salem, OR has 61/100, based on FBI Uniform Crime Report data.

What is the violent crime rate in Elgin, IL vs Salem, OR?

Elgin, IL has a violent crime rate of 266.7 per 100,000 residents, while Salem, OR has 532.2 per 100,000. Lower rates indicate safer communities. The national average is approximately 380 per 100,000.

What is the property crime rate in Elgin, IL vs Salem, OR?

Elgin, IL has a property crime rate of 1102.1 per 100,000, compared to 2803.3 per 100,000 in Salem, OR. Property crimes include burglary, theft, and motor vehicle theft.
